1. According to ASTM C1064, the sensor of the temperature measuring device shall be submerged a
minimum of how many inches into the freshly mixed concrete?
A) 1 inch (25 mm)
B) 2 inches (50 mm)
C) 3 inches (75 mm)
D) 4 inches (100 mm)
CORRECT ANSWER: C
Rationale: ASTM C1064 requires the temperature sensor to be submerged at least 3 inches (75 mm) to
ensure an accurate reading of the concrete’s internal temperature, avoiding surface temperature
variations. This ensures the measurement reflects the true temperature of the concrete mass.
2. The temperature measuring device used for fresh concrete shall be capable of measuring
temperature to within what accuracy?
A) ±0.5°F (±0.3°C)
B) ±1°F (±0.5°C)
C) ±2°F (±1°C)
D) ±5°F (±3°C)
CORRECT ANSWER: B
Rationale: ASTM C1064 specifies that the temperature measuring device must be accurate to ±1°F
(±0.5°C) throughout the required range of 30°F to 120°F. This level of precision is necessary to verify
conformance with specified temperature requirements.
,3. What temperature range must a thermometer used for fresh concrete testing be capable of
measuring?
A) 0°F to 100°F (–18°C to 38°C)
B) 20°F to 110°F (–7°C to 43°C)
C) 30°F to 120°F (–1°C to 49°C)
D) 40°F to 130°F (4°C to 54°C)
CORRECT ANSWER: C
Rationale: ASTM C1064 requires thermometers to be capable of measuring temperatures throughout
the range of 30°F to 120°F (–1°C to 49°C). This range covers typical concrete temperatures encountered
in field conditions, including hot and cold weather concreting.
4. According to ASTM C1064, how often must the temperature measuring device be calibrated?
A) Monthly
B) Quarterly
C) Annually
D) Before each use
CORRECT ANSWER: C
Rationale: ASTM C1064 requires annual calibration of temperature measuring devices, or whenever
there is a question of accuracy. Regular calibration ensures reliable temperature measurements.
5. A composite sample of concrete is required when the only purpose for obtaining the sample is to
determine temperature. True or False?
A) True
B) False
,CORRECT ANSWER: B
Rationale: A composite sample is not required when the sole purpose is temperature determination.
Temperature can be measured directly from a single grab sample without the need for a composite
sample.
6. How long must the temperature measuring device remain in the freshly mixed concrete before
reading the temperature?
A) At least 30 seconds but not more than 2 minutes
B) At least 1 minute but not more than 3 minutes
C) At least 2 minutes but not more than 5 minutes
D) At least 5 minutes but not more than 10 minutes
CORRECT ANSWER: C
Rationale: ASTM C1064 requires the temperature measuring device to remain in the concrete for a
minimum of 2 minutes and a maximum of 5 minutes to allow the sensor to reach equilibrium with the
concrete temperature.
7. After the temperature of the concrete is read, what is required?
A) Discard the sample immediately
B) Reporting of temperature
C) Perform a slump test
D) Rod the sample 25 times
CORRECT ANSWER: B
Rationale: After reading the temperature, the result must be reported to the nearest 1°F (0.5°C).
Proper documentation ensures traceability and quality control.
8. According to ASTM C1064, what is one reason to take the temperature of concrete?
, A) To determine compressive strength
B) To verify conformance to a specified temperature requirement
C) To measure air content
D) To determine workability
CORRECT ANSWER: B
Rationale: One of the primary reasons for measuring concrete temperature is to verify conformance to
a specified requirement for temperature of concrete, such as in hot or cold weather concreting.
9. ASTM C1064 specifies a maximum temperature for freshly mixed concrete. True or False?
A) True
B) False
CORRECT ANSWER: B
Rationale: ASTM C1064 does not specify maximum or minimum temperature limits. It only provides
the method for measuring temperature. Temperature limits are typically specified by project
specifications.
